The Prodigal Son
The Prodigal Son leaves home and squanders his inheritance in riotous living. His elder brother stays home and works hard. When the prodigal returns and is restored to his father, the elder brother becomes petty, jealous, bitter, and resentful. Despite their different paths into carnality, their sins cannot remove them from the circumstances of their birth. Once a son, always a son!
As a “born again” believer, whether you sin like the prodigal or like the elder brother, you remain a permanent member of the family of God, but you lose your temporal fellowship with God. To remedy this rift, God has provided a simple, grace procedure—rebound—so that your postsalvation sins are forgiven and you can recover fellowship and move on in the Christian life.
Jesus taught the parable of the prodigal son to an audience of self-righteous legalists who reviled the profligate prodigal and praised the holier-than-thou elder brother. Yet, they entirely missed the message! Everyone who believes in Christ by faith alone is a permanent son of God. Once a family member, any believer can reclaim his Christian life from carnality and be restored to fellowship with God. |

The Trinity
The Trinity is a doctrine unique to Christianity. No other faith, religion, sect, or philosophy that advocates one God also proclaims that God is Three-in-One. This apparent paradox does not mean there are ‘three gods in one,' but that one God exists as three persons who are coequal, coinfinite, and coeternal, all possessing the same essential nature. God is one in essence, but three in persons.
The Trinity is not abstract theology, but a practical doctrine that you should comprehend. Your understanding of the plan God the Father has designed for you illuminates your destiny in time and eternity. Your understanding of the person and work of Jesus Christ illuminates your so-great salvation. Your understanding of the Holy Spirit affects your concept of living the Christian life. Only by perceiving the true biblical perspective of the Trinity can you come to love God, grow spiritually, and fulfill your very own spiritual life. |
